How to Hire and Manage the Right Team for Your Small Business

Hiring the right people can make or break your small business. As your brand grows, so does the need for a team that aligns with your values, understands your vision, and contributes to your success. But hiring and managing staff can feel overwhelming—especially without an HR framework in place.

Step 1: Define the Roles You Actually Need

Before you begin the recruitment process, take a step back to assess your current business needs.

  • What tasks are you handling that could be delegated?
  • Which skills are missing in your business?
  • What roles will directly contribute to revenue or productivity?

Clearly outlining job responsibilities helps you avoid hiring based on assumptions or trends—and ensures each new hire adds tangible value.

Step 2: Write Strategic Job Descriptions

Don’t just copy and paste job listings from the internet. Customise your job description to reflect your company culture, mission, and performance expectations. Include:

  • A clear job title
  • Key responsibilities
  • Required and preferred skills
  • Expected outcomes or KPIs
  • Work hours, location, and benefits

Tip: Use relevant keywords like “remote admin assistant,” “creative project manager,” or “entry-level marketing officer” to improve visibility on job boards.

Step 3: Implement a Smart Hiring Process

Structure your recruitment in three stages:

  1. Application screening (based on skills and alignment with company culture)
  2. A short task or assessment (to gauge ability and commitment)
  3.  A structured interview (to assess communication, problem-solving, and values)

Step 4: Onboard Like a Pro

An onboarding process is not a luxury—it’s a necessity. New team members need clarity, direction, and a sense of belonging from day one.
Create an onboarding checklist that includes:

  • Company overview
  • Tools and software access
  • Role expectations
  • Communication channels
  • Trial period guidelines

Good onboarding builds loyalty and prevents costly misunderstandings.

Step 5: Set Expectations and Performance Systems

Once hired, your team needs structure to thrive. Define what success looks like for each role, and set up regular check-ins. Use:

  • Weekly reports
  • Task trackers (e.g., Trello or Notion)
  • Monthly performance reviews
  • Clear goals and incentives

Pro tip: Avoid micromanagement—focus on outcomes, not hours.

Step 6: Lead with Culture and Communication

Retention isn’t just about salaries—it’s about leadership, respect, and inclusion.

  • Create a feedback loop
  • Hold space for growth conversations
  • Celebrate wins and milestones
  • Be transparent about business goals
